Abstract
- We demonstrate a compact and broadband 1 × 4 optical switch based on W2 photonic crystal waveguides (PCWs). The footprint of the W2 PCW is only 17.6 μm × 8 μm. An operation bandwidth of 15 nm ± 1 nm is implemented with an extinction ratio over 15 dB in each channel. By introducing the thermal insulation trench, the tuning efficiency is enhanced at least 77% in experiment. The experimental results indicate the potential of the proposed broadband thermo-optic switch in silicon on-chip interconnects.
